Seat-value framework
Seats are not equal in value. We assess:
- Sightlines: Clear view to ring, stage, or center circle.
- Price bands: Balance between proximity and angle, not just raw distance.
- Access: Aisle seats for families and quicker exits if you plan merch or prayer breaks.
- Venue shape: Raised lower sides often beat deeper corners. Upper-center can beat low sides when big camera rigs block sight.
When a card, stage, or camera plan changes, value can shift. We flag these shifts and update recommendations.
